Digital marketing is particularly effective for targeting specific geographical markets due to its capabilities in precision and customization. Through various digital channels, such as social media, search engine advertising, and geo-targeted email campaigns, property managers can reach potential clients who are located in particular areas.

Digital marketing allows for the use of analytics to identify and understand local trends and demographics. By employing targeted advertisements that focus on geographic data, property managers can ensure that their marketing efforts are directed toward the individuals who are most likely to be interested in their services, thereby increasing engagement and conversion rates.

In contrast, psychographic marketing focuses on the psychological profile of potential customers, including their interests and lifestyle choices, which is less about geographic targeting and more about understanding what drives consumers. Traditional marketing methods such as print media or billboards typically lack the agility and specificity that digital marketing provides. Referral marketing relies on word-of-mouth recommendations, which may not always effectively target specific geographic areas, making it less efficient for this purpose.
